Radio not working
My radio cut out over the weekend. Nothing about it is working. The display screen will not show anything. Even at night when I turn on my lights, the whole system does not receive any power. All the buttons do not glow so I know I am convinced it is not receiving power to it. does anybody know a way how to reboot it in any way? If not, is there a write-up on how I can remove my radio to check the connections?

Sounds basic, but have you checked the fuse in the fuse panel?
Some Ford Systems also a secondary one attached dirctly to the back of the stereo which would mean you would need to remove the system to check it.
check the primary one in the fuse box first. It's on the passenger side by the door under the kick panel.

Thanks guys, got it working now. I am not sure exactly what the problem was, but i took out the radio, replugged it back in, and pulled the fuses and replugged them back in and it seems to work now.
